Re: even/uneven tape cycle / ANR1025W

2004-04-15 Thread Deon George
Yes, If you have some Filling/Empty volumes that are NOT Read-Write, then TSM will attempt to get one that is read-write, or attempt to get a scratch volume if there are none. Then if your MAXSCR is less than or equal to the number of scratch volumes used, you'll get a server out of storage

Re: AW: Upgrade Library 3494

2004-04-15 Thread Prather, Wanda
Up to you: When you do audit library, it defaults to loading each tape to verify the internal label. If you don't want that (And I have never had a case where I thought it was needed), you specify AUDIT LIBRARY blah CHECKLABEL=BARCODE On the 3494, that causes it to just exchange information
